FHA Loans

If you are FHA mortgage loans require 3.5 percent down, that money may be readily available courtesy a deposit guidance system. The new Government Homes Administration (FHA) is the biggest mortgage insurance carrier around the globe. The FHA financial brings

You can find good and bad points to an enthusiastic FHA financing, so it’s important to correspond with that loan officer that you can trust

  • First-time home buyers.
  • Readers having credit ratings lower than 620.
  • Readers who would like to build a low deposit.

A decreased down payment is possible just like the FHA pledges the mortgage to your bank by the providing mortgage insurance. Clients coverage the new month-to-month superior. It is no Longer simple for the home buyer so you can cancel the borrowed funds insurance policies.

Example: To your a beneficial $2 hundred,one hundred thousand home with step 3.5 percent down, FHA carry out costs an initial insurance premium of 1.75 per cent, otherwise $step three,377 funded with the financing. Additionally, the new month-to-month home loan insurance coverage do put in the $140 with the month-to-month homeloan payment. Conversely, for many who qualify for a conventional mortgage which have 5 percent off, the private financial insurance rates won’t fees an initial commission and you will the new month-to-month advanced could well be about $ninety, dependent on fico scores.

And you may, in the event the nothing of these work for you, you will find conventional funds which need only step 3 % off. You will find several exceptions to the money fee. If the experienced is actually handicapped because of the Virtual assistant and receives Va handicap, the brand new resource payment is wholly excused! It indicates a handicapped experienced can get a good Va mortgage loan to possess 100 % funding, no cash down and no financial support payment included.
